我正在尝试获取4.9.1的GCC源代码来编译它debian.我用谷歌搜索"如何安装GCC",它指导我到这个页面.
在那里,在下载源,它声称GCC通过SVN分发,链接到此页面.它提供了以下用于下载GCC中继存储库的命令:
svn checkout svn://gcc.gnu.org/svn/gcc/trunk SomeLocalDir
Run Code Online (Sandbox Code Playgroud)
除了我想要最新版本,而不是主干分支.进一步在该页面上,它将此作为获取特定分支的示例:
svn co svn://gcc.gnu.org/svn/gcc/branches/branchname gcc
Run Code Online (Sandbox Code Playgroud)
所以我安装subversion并试图替换branchname用gcc_4_9_1_release(和一帮,我不会打扰上市其他组合的),它产生这个错误:
svn: URL 'svn://gcc.gnu.org/svn/gcc/branches/gcc-4_9_1_release' doesn't exist
Run Code Online (Sandbox Code Playgroud)
无论如何,相同的下载页面还有一个指向假定版本页面的链接,该页面包含可能在某个时刻托管GCC的死链接列表.
我不记得这很难.如果有人能告诉我他们如何获得这个独家软件,我将不胜感激.
使用svn ls svn://gcc.gnu.org/svn/gcc/branches看到所有分支.然后,您将看到GCC的最新分支是gcc-4_9-branch /.
然后使用svn签出最新的分支.在这种情况下,它将是:
svn co svn://gcc.gnu.org/svn/gcc/branches/gcc-4_9-branch gcc
Run Code Online (Sandbox Code Playgroud)
然后,您将能够使用提供的make文件对其进行编译.
| 归档时间: |
|
| 查看次数: |
2765 次 |
| 最近记录: |